About Ch. Kessler

Ch. Kessler is a scholar working on Atmospheric Science, Health, Toxicology and Mutagenesis and Automotive Engineering, having authored 7 papers that have together received 277 indexed citations. Recurring topics across this work include Atmospheric chemistry and aerosols (7 papers), Air Quality and Health Impacts (5 papers) and Vehicle emissions and performance (3 papers). The work is most often cited by research in Atmospheric Science (218 citations), Health, Toxicology and Mutagenesis (164 citations) and Environmental Engineering (71 citations). Ch. Kessler has collaborated with scholars based in Germany and Greece. Frequent co-authors include Ν. Moussiopoulos, Peter R. Sahm, Nicole Riemer, I.J. Ackermann, H. Vogel, Bernhard Vogel, H. Hass, B. Schell, A. Ebel and Hermann Jakobs. Their work appears in journals such as Journal of Geophysical Research Atmospheres, Atmospheric Environment and International Journal of Environment and Pollution.
